GN’s Environmental Policy addresses our pollution-related negative impact in terms of substances used during both production in our own operations and outsourced manufacturing. Our policy commitments include compliance with all pollution-related legislation related to the use of substances of concern and very high concern, such as REACH and RoHS, and the substitution of substances with less harmful alternatives that can fulfill the same purpose, even when not legally required. This policy is supported by internal procedures on controlling and limiting the impact of incidents and emergency situations. Our Supplier Code of Conduct covers supplier requirements in terms of pollution, specifically addressing our negative impacts relating to our value chain. Through this, we expect suppliers to comply with all pollution-related legislation and proactively minimize or eliminate emissions and discharges of pollution, which can have a potential negative impact on the pollution of water, soil and food.
